COUNTY OF HAWAII - TERRITORY OF HAWAII
RESOLUTION NO. 70
WHEREAS, the hopes and aspirations of the people of Hawaii
for equal rights and privileges with all other_ citizens of the
United States have been realized by passage of the bill
admitting the State of Hawaii into the Union; and
WHEREAS, it is particularly appropriate that special
thanks be given to those members of the Congress of the
United States whose patient and tireless personal efforts
on behalf of the people of`Hawaii brought about the eventual
.fulfillment .of these hopes;
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E BOARD OF SUPERVISORS
in and for the County of Hawaii that the personal thanks and
fondest aloha of the people of Hawaii be and they are hereby
given to the Honorable Representative John P. Saylor of the
great State of Pennsylvania, ranking Minority Member of the
Committee on Territories and Insular Affairs of the House of
Representatives'of the Congress of the United States, for his
patient, thoughtful and untiring efforts on their behalf to
attain for them full and equal rights and privileges with all
other citizens of the United States by the granting of
statehood to Hawaii; and
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that a certified copy of this
resolution be sent forthwith to the Honorable John P. Saylor..
Dated at Hilo, Hawaii, this ,18th day of March, 1959,
